Career path

Career Role (International Environmental Arbitration) Description
International Environmental Lawyer Specializes in resolving environmental disputes across borders, leveraging expertise in international law and arbitration. High demand for expertise in treaty interpretation and compliance.
Environmental Arbitrator Neutrally adjudicates environmental conflicts using arbitration procedures, requiring deep knowledge of environmental regulations and international arbitration processes. A senior role with significant responsibility.
Environmental Consultant (Dispute Resolution) Provides technical and legal support in international environmental arbitration cases, often assisting lawyers and arbitrators with expert analysis. Strong technical and communication skills essential.
Legal Researcher (International Environmental Law) Supports legal teams involved in international environmental arbitration by conducting in-depth legal research on relevant treaties, case law and regulations. Focus on precise and timely information delivery.
